Sweet Protection Fixer 2Vi Full Face Helmet on Review – Style Icon or Pricey Bling?
Summary By: eMotoX
Norwegian brand Sweet Protection has introduced the Fixer Carbon 2Vi, a premium full face helmet that has already gained attention on the World Cup circuit and at major events like Crankworx. Weighing just 1,025 grams in size L, this helmet is notably lightweight for its category and incorporates advanced safety features such as the MIPS system integrated with the proprietary 2Vi® technology. Priced at €699, the Fixer Carbon 2Vi sits alongside other high-end helmets in terms of cost, although savvy buyers may find it for closer to €500 online.
The helmet’s design emphasises both protection and comfort. Its carbon prepreg shell balances rigidity with flexibility, while Multi-Density EPS Impact Shields help absorb and distribute impact forces. The dual-layer MIPS system is tailored to reduce rotational forces from angled impacts, addressing a common vulnerability in helmet safety. Additional features include an adjustable, breakaway visor, removable cheek pads with two thickness options for a customised fit, and 11 strategically placed vents that maintain airflow and reduce heat buildup. It also meets multiple safety certifications, including European, US, ASTM F1952-15 for downhill use, and the NTA 8776 standard for e-bike riders.
On the trail, the Fixer Carbon 2Vi impresses with its fit and ventilation. The helmet sits comfortably without pressure points, and the cheek pads’ fabric manages moisture well, staying damp rather than soaking wet during extended rides. Ventilation remains effective even in hot conditions, and the wide field of vision enhances trail awareness. Compared to rivals such as the FOX Rampage RS and Smith Hardline Carbon, the Fixer Carbon 2Vi sits slightly further forward on the head, bringing the chin bar closer to the face, though this becomes less noticeable over time. A minor drawback is the double D-ring strap’s magnetic end, which can be fiddly to secure, especially with gloves or cold fingers.
Sweet Protection also offers a more affordable alternative in the Fixer Composite 2Vi, which shares the same safety technology but weighs slightly more and retails for €449. The Fixer Carbon 2Vi is available in five sizes and two colour options, with matching goggles designed to fit seamlessly, though it also pairs well with other popular goggles like the Oakley Airbrake. Overall, the helmet delivers a blend of lightweight construction, advanced safety, and comfort, making it a compelling choice for serious gravity riders despite its premium price point.
